Output 58baa3da5f5dd9467b4f218fe5e7db35ef72fc2107b9ac404b0decbfb0c09724:16

value
22918779
script pubkey
OP_0 OP_PUSHBYTES_32 e474fb57fa6409955f22129bbf11802f12136f02cb057eb07e97d5320f53588a
address
bc1qu360k4l6vsye2hezz2dm7yvq9ufpxmczevzhavr7jl2nyr6ntz9q3m9z56
transaction
58baa3da5f5dd9467b4f218fe5e7db35ef72fc2107b9ac404b0decbfb0c09724
spent
true